Jobs at Aurelexa

Frontend Developer (React.js)

at Aurelexa • Full-time

Location

remote

Experience

3-5 years

Compensation

$35k-$60k

Posted 1mo ago

by
Profile Picture of Cindy

Cindy D

About this Opportunity

About the Role

Aurelexa is hiring a Frontend Developer to build the core token ecosystem powering our platform. You will work on a production-grade system that combines ERC-20 token infrastructure, a high-performance backend, real-time market data, and a trading-focused application layer.

Responsibilities

  • Build and maintain responsive trading UI components using React 18 and TypeScript across Swap, Limit, Buy, Sell, Trade, and Markets pages.

  • Integrate real-time WebSocket data into live UI updates — order books, price tickers, trade feeds, and candlestick charts.

  • Implement transaction signing and submission for swap, mint, and order flows via Viem, replacing paper trading placeholders with real on-chain execution.

  • Own the wallet connection experience across 8+ providers using EIP-6963, and collaborate with the smart contract developer on ABI integration and on-chain event handling.

  • Connect frontend to backend REST APIs for market data, order management, and swap quotes, ensuring consistent data contracts across the stack.

  • Write clean, well-typed TypeScript with a focus on component reusability, performance, and maintainability.

Requirements

  • 3+ years of professional frontend development experience with React and TypeScript in a production environment.

  • Strong proficiency in React 18 — hooks, context, component architecture, and performance optimization.

  • Solid experience consuming REST APIs and WebSocket streams for real-time data rendering.

  • Hands-on experience with Tailwind CSS and responsive, accessible UI design.

  • Familiarity with Web3 frontend integration — wallet connection, transaction signing, and contract interaction via Viem or Ethers.js.

  • Experience with charting libraries such as lightweight-charts, klinecharts, or TradingView.

  • Comfortable working in a monorepo structure and collaborating across frontend, backend, and smart contract teams.

Tech Stack

  • Frontend: React 18 + TypeScript — trading UI, component architecture, real-time data handling.

  • Styling: Tailwind CSS + PostCSS — utility-first responsive design, custom animations.

  • Routing: React Router v6 — client-side navigation across trading pages.

  • Real-Time Systems: WebSocket client — live market prices, order book updates, trade feed streaming.

  • Charting: lightweight-charts + klinecharts — candlestick charts, real-time price rendering.

  • State Management: React Context — Config, Wallet, Markets, Favorites, PaperTrade providers.

  • Optional Integrations: RainbowKit — wallet connection UI, swap quote fetching via backend API.

Nice to Have

  • Experience with RainbowKit or similar wallet connection UI libraries.

  • Familiarity with Viem or Ethers.js for on-chain contract interaction and transaction handling.

  • Prior work on a DEX, trading platform, or any DeFi-related frontend.

  • Understanding of ERC-20 token standards and how they surface in UI flows (balances, approvals, transfers).

  • Experience integrating TradingView, lightweight-charts, or klinecharts for financial data visualization.

  • Familiarity with WebSocket-driven architectures and managing live data state efficiently.

  • Experience working in an npm workspaces monorepo alongside backend and smart contract teams.

  • Comfort with Hardhat local network for testing frontend-to-contract integration end to end.

  • Eye for financial UI/UX — order books, depth charts, trade history tables, and position panels.

Why Join Us

  • Own the frontend end to end — from chart interactions and order entry to wallet flows and on-chain transaction submission, your work directly shapes what users see and experience.

  • Build at the intersection of finance and Web3 — real-time markets, DEX swaps, limit orders, and on-chain token mechanics all in one product.

  • Collaborate closely with smart contract and backend developers in a small, focused team where your input influences architecture and product decisions.

  • Greenfield features ahead — swap execution, fiat on/off-ramps, margin trading UI, and perpetuals are all on the roadmap, giving you room to grow and lead.

  • Remote-first, async-friendly culture with the flexibility to do your best work on your own schedule.

  • Early-stage opportunity to join before scale — your contributions will be visible, credited, and lasting.

Contract & Payment Terms

  • You will be engaged as an independent contractor.

  • This is a fully remote role with flexible working hours, with some overlap expected during core collaboration time (10 AM – 4 PM EST).

  • Competitive hourly compensation ($30–$50/hour), flexible based on experience and expertise.

  • Opportunity for performance-based increases and long-term collaboration.

  • Payments are made weekly via ACH, PayPal, or Wise based on services rendered.

About Aurelexa

Aurelexa is a global technology company focused on building scalable, high-performance digital solutions. We partner with startups and enterprises to deliver innovative products powered by modern technologies and strong engineering practices.

Apply here: https://aurelexa.com/hire-reactjs-developers

Find the perfect job!

Use Job Hunt AI to find the perfect job for you.

Job Hunt AI